>>>>> Hi Shan,
>>>>>
>>>>> As we discussed, we are going to do following changes:
>>>>>
>>>>> 1. Change the message in setting server IP screen.
>>>>> Change from *Set your server address here to start registration, i.e
>>>>> : www.abc.com <http://www.abc.com>"* to "*Set your MDM server
>>>>> address"*
>>>>>
>>>>> 2. In login screen, currently we have inputs as following order:
>>>>> i. Domain
>>>>> ii. Username
>>>>> iii Password
>>>>>
>>>>> We are going to change it as:
>>>>> i. Username
>>>>> ii. Password
>>>>> iii. Group (We are using this for tenancy)
>>>>>
>>>>> *Note:* Here I have attached the server IP screen(setServerIP.png)
>>>>> and the login screen(login.png).
>>>>>
>>>>> *Improvements:*
>>>>>
>>>>> 1. We should allow to add pin code, only for users who is able to wipe
>>>>> the device. For that we(Android agent) need to get that information from
>>>>> the server side *after the login*, but *before completing the
>>>>> registration*. Then there will be changes in both server side and
>>>>> android agent.
>>>>>
>>>>> 2. We should allow user to do the registration even *without seeing
>>>>> license agreement* if *he/she requires*. There cannot be any screen
>>>>> between the registration and registration successful screens. For that we
>>>>> need to include a check box. We need to decide the screen where we have to
>>>>> add this.
>>>>>
>>>>> If we are going to implement this, since there are many logical
>>>>> implementation based on the license agreement in Android Agent, we have to
>>>>> do a major change in Android Agent.
